The Bosnian Language
Before we jump into the words and phrases, let us have a glance at the nature of the Bosnian language.
The Bosnian language belongs to the South Slavic group of the Slavic language branch of the Indo-European language family. When Yugoslavia got divided, the official language known as the Serbo-Croatian, the then language of the Serbs, Croats, Bosniaks, and Montenegrins, split into three distinct languages. Croatia got its Croatian language, Serbia got its Serbian language, and Bosnia got Bosnian language. However, even though all three nations have quite different cultures and practices now, their language still shares a common sound system, vocabulary, and grammar. So, if you are known to any of the two languages, Bosnian can become a little easier for you.
The Bosnian language has a complex dialect and is the same for the other two languages. However, it is said that Bosnia is still much easier to learn and write than the other Slavic languages and is not impossible. General Short Bosnian Phrases
To make things more inclusive, here is a list of some common and general short phrases that you can use as you see fit.
English | Bosnian | Sound |
Take care | Čuvaj se | |
Let’s go | Idemo | |
Are you ready? | Da li si spreman? | |
What’s up? | Šta ima? | |
Hold on | Čekaj | |
Have fun | Zabavi se | |
Happy journey | Sretan put | |
See you | Vidimo se |
